We address the problem on uniform parallel batch machines to minimize makespan where each job is restricted to a specific subset of machines, known as its processing set. Batch machines have diverse speeds and capacities. Each batch machine has the ability to concurrently process multiple jobs as long as the capacity allows. The length of a batch is defined as the largest length of all the jobs contained within it. We present fast approximation algorithms for inclusive processing set.
